## Action Item: Version pinning for the Lanternkit component library

For new team members: the outage traced back to consumer apps floating on Lanternkit's latest minor release, which shipped a breaking prop rename. Going forward, all consumers must pin within an approved range, and the CI gate enforces it. The enforcement thresholds are defined by these constants.

constants for kageg-bawif:
QUOTAS = {
    "quenwyn": 1,
    "oliix": 10,
}

Flagwheel evaluates rollout rules at session start, so a flag toggled off mid-session will not take effect until the customer reloads. Check the evaluation timestamp in the Flagwheel panel before escalating. Also note that percentage-based rollouts hash on account ID, not user ID, so two users on the same account always match together. If the timestamps align and behavior still diverges, capture the rule snapshot and file a ticket. The full evaluation-order reference lives on our internal page.

operations page: https://jenkins.zemvarcloud.local/job/merge_requests/repo/build/73930b4b30f0a8ed

Hey, release-manager-on-duty: the blue-green deploy for the invoicer-worker stalled last night because the green stack was still using the credential we retired in the Quillbox rotation two weeks ago. Health checks passed (annoyingly) since they don't touch the billing API, so traffic shifted and then charges started bouncing. I rolled back to blue and rotated a fresh credential for green. Please don't flip the switch again until smoke tests cover an actual charge call. The rotated key for the green environment is below.

service key, fawip-bajef: kto11_Qt5wZK9vdNC